Barvo Barvo N. Walker, a name synonymous with sculpture, was called home to be with his Lord and Savior on 1/15/2022. Raised by his grandparents, Mr. and Mrs. J.M Pledger of Fort Worth, he attended Arlington Heights High School before the University of Texas and TCU. In 1956, he then found his way to Dallas after being accepted to the Baylor Dental School where he graduated with honors after being selected in 1959 by the American Dental Association as the outstanding Senior Dental student in America. Graduate studies followed at the Pennsylvania School of Dentistry. Retirement from dentistry came early in 1982. Thus began his foray into the artistic world as a sculptor/painter. A lifelong passion, this enabled him to support himself until the day he passed.
